adidas AG (XETR:ADS) shares slipped about 2.2% after management kept guidance unchanged ahead of Q2 results due July 30, with analysts penciling in ~€6.63B sales and ~€623M operating profit, even as the firm presses on with a second buyback tranche, repurchasing 962,604 ADS to date.
